Smart Time Slots for a Stress-Free Experience
Once you’ve picked a day, time your meetup to miss typical rushes. Consider these smoother windows:
- Late Lunch (2–4 PM): A sweet spot between midday and after-work crowds—perfect for catching up with friends when you want conversation and room to breathe.
- Early Evening (4–6 PM): Slide in before prime-time traffic. You still get that warm, pre-dinner energy without the bottleneck.
- Later Nightcap (after the dinner rush): If your crew prefers a laid-back vibe, meet a little later to soak in the ambience, the craft beers, and the baseball nostalgia with minimal waiting.

Why Bleacher Bar Works So Well for Holiday Meetups
Beyond the holidays, Bleacher Bar is a go-to for year-round Fenway connection. Our space lives where the visiting team’s batting cage once stood, literally beneath the bleachers, creating a baseball time-capsule feel that fans and first-timers both love. It’s the combination of the massive centerfield window, the cozy vantage point into the park, and the casual, welcoming energy that makes it a natural choice for small celebrations, friendly reunions, and after-work mixers .
Because we’re built for both game days and non-game days, you can curate your own experience: chase the buzz when you want it, or choose quieter pockets that let the conversation—and the history—take center stage .
